Transcriptional Analysis of the Global Regulatory Networks Active in Pseudomonas syringae during Leaf Colonization
The plant pathogen Pseudomonas syringae pv. syringae B728a grows and survives on leaf surfaces and in the leaf apoplast of its host, bean (Phaseolus vulgaris).
